def get_module_var( 

path: Path | str, var: str = "__version__", abort=True 

) -> str | None: 

"""extract from a python module in path the module level <var> variable 

 

Args: 

path (str,Path): python module file to parse using ast (no code-execution) 

var (str): module level variable name to extract 

abort (bool): raise MissingVariable if var is not present 

 

Returns: 

None or str: the variable value if found or None 

 

Raises: 

MissingVariable: if the var is not found and abort is True 

 

Notes: 

this uses ast to parse path, so it doesn't load the module 

""" 

 

class V(ast.NodeVisitor): 

def __init__(self, keys): 

self.keys = keys 

self.result = {} 

 

def visit_Module(self, node): # noqa: N802 

# we extract the module level variables 

for subnode in ast.iter_child_nodes(node): 

if not isinstance(subnode, ast.Assign): 

continue 

for target in subnode.targets: 

if target.id not in self.keys: 

continue 

if not isinstance(subnode.value, (ast.Num, ast.Str, ast.Constant)): 

raise ValidationError( 

f"cannot extract non Constant variable " 

f"{target.id} ({type(subnode.value)})" 

) 

if isinstance(subnode.value, ast.Str): 

value = subnode.value.s 

elif isinstance(subnode.value, ast.Num): 

value = subnode.value.n 

else: 

value = subnode.value.value 

if target.id in self.result: 

raise ValidationError( 

f"found multiple repeated variables {target.id}" 

) 

self.result[target.id] = value 

return self.generic_visit(node) 

 

v = V({var}) 

path = Path(path) 

if path.exists(): 

tree = ast.parse(Path(path).read_text()) 

v.visit(tree) 

if var not in v.result and abort: 

raise MissingVariableError(f"cannot find {var} in {path}", path, var) 

return v.result.get(var, None)

def bump_version(version: str, mode: str) -> str: 

"""given a version str will bump it according to mode 

 

Arguments: 

version: text in the N.M.O form 

mode: major, minor or micro 

 

Returns: 

increased text 

 

>>> bump_version("1.0.3", "micro") 

"1.0.4" 

>>> bump_version("1.0.3", "minor") 

"1.1.0" 

""" 

newver = [int(n) for n in version.split(".")] 

if mode == "major": 

newver[-3] += 1 

newver[-2] = 0 

newver[-1] = 0 

elif mode == "minor": 

newver[-2] += 1 

newver[-1] = 0 

elif mode == "micro": 

newver[-1] += 1 

return ".".join(str(v) for v in newver)
